**The Fundamental Classes:**
1. **A-Class**: The A-Class serves as the entry-level vehicle in the Mercedes-Benz range, featuring a compact and chic design. It enjoys popularity among city dwellers and those desiring a premium ambiance in a smaller format. The A-Class comes in hatchback or sedan styles and is recognized for its innovative technology and efficient performance.
2. **B-Class**: The B-Class is a compact MPV (multi-purpose vehicle) that delivers additional space and practicality compared to the A-Class. It suits families or those requiring extra capacity for passengers and cargo while maintaining a compact size.
3. **C-Class**: The C-Class is a cornerstone in the Mercedes-Benz collection, celebrated for its equilibrium of luxury, performance, and value. Offered in sedan, coupe, and convertible configurations, the C-Class provides various engines and trims to cater to diverse preferences.
4. **E-Class**: The E-Class is a mid-sized luxury automobile that epitomizes sophistication and state-of-the-art technology. It comes in sedan, coupe, convertible, and wagon forms, appealing to a broad spectrum of tastes. The E-Class is frequently lauded for its comfort, safety features, and robust engine selections.
5. **S-Class**: The S-Class stands as the zenith of Mercedes-Benz luxury and innovation. As the flagship vehicle, it boasts the most advanced technology, unparalleled comfort, and remarkable performance. The S-Class is offered as a sedan, coupe, or convertible and is widely regarded as a standard for luxury vehicles globally.
**SUVs and Crossovers:**
1. **GLA-Class**: The GLA-Class is a compact crossover that merges the nimbleness of a smaller vehicle with the adaptability of an SUV. It is ideal for individuals desiring a higher driving position and increased cargo space without compromising maneuverability.
2. **GLB-Class**: The GLB-Class is a flexible compact SUV that provides enhanced space and an optional third row of seating. It is crafted for families and explorers who need additional room and versatility.
3. **GLC-Class**: The GLC-Class is a mid-sized SUV that harmonizes luxury, performance, and functionality. Available in traditional SUV and coupe-like designs, the GLC is a favored choice for those pursuing a premium SUV experience.
4. **GLE-Class**: The GLE-Class is a bigger SUV that delivers greater space and power than the GLC. It comes with a variety of engines and features, including an optional third row of seats, making it perfect for families and those in need of extra capacity.
5. **GLS-Class**: The GLS-Class is the largest SUV within the Mercedes-Benz lineup, often termed the “S-Class of SUVs.” It offers generous space, luxury, and advanced features, making it ideal for those seeking the ultimate SUV experience.
6. **G-Class**: The G-Class, commonly known as the “G-Wagon,” is a legendary off-road vehicle celebrated for its tough design and exceptional off-road abilities. Despite its practical origins, the G-Class features a luxurious interior and outstanding performance.
**Specialty Vehicles:**
1. **CLA-Class**: The CLA-Class is a compact four-door coupe that presents a fashionable and sporty alternative to conventional sedans. It is designed for enthusiasts who value design and performance in a compact format.
2. **CLS-Class**: The CLS-Class is a mid-sized luxury coupe that fuses the grace of a coupe with the practicality of a sedan. It is recognized for its streamlined design and powerful engine options.
3. **AMG GT**: The AMG GT is a high-performance sports automobile crafted by Mercedes-AMG. It delivers exhilarating performance, advanced technology, and a stunning design, making it a preferred choice among driving aficionados.
**Deciphering the Naming System:**
Mercedes-Benz model designations typically begin with a letter or letters denoting the class, followed by a number that often signifies the engine size or power output. For instance, the E350 denotes an E-Class model equipped with a 3.5-liter engine. Additionally, models featuring “4MATIC” in their title indicate the inclusion of Mercedes-Benz’s all-wheel-drive system.
